Francisco Sánchez Lara

Francisco Javier Sánchez Lara is a Spanish wheelchair basketball player. He represented Spain at the 2012 Summer Paralympics as a member of Spain men's national team.

Personal
Sánchez was born on 11 August 1989 in Bolanos de Calatrava, Castilla–La Mancha, and continued to reside there in 2012. In 2012, he had a sports scholarship from the Castilla-La Mancha Olímpica (CLAMO) program run by the regional government. == Wheelchair basketball ==
Wheelchair basketball
Sánchez is a guard, National team Sánchez was selected for the national team's Paralympic campaign by Oscar Trigo in 2011. His selection to represent Spain at the 2011 European Championships was made in March. The championship was held in Turkey. He was chosen for the 2012 team ahead of Jonatan Soria and José Luis Robles. Sánchez competed in wheelchair basketball at the 2012 Summer Paralympics in London. In London, he was coached by Oscar Trigo. His team finished fifth overall. Sánchez was a member of the national team at the 2013 European Championships. His team finished with a bronze medal after defeating Sweden. Club In 2009, Sánchez played for Fuhnpaiin-Peraleda de Toledo. In 2010 and 2011, he played for Fundación Grupo Norte. He played a key role in guiding the team to a league title in the 2010/2011 season and in assisting the team in being runners up in the Copa del Rey. During the 2011/2012 season, he played for CID Casa Murcia Getafe. In 2013, he played club wheelchair basketball for Padova Millenium. == References ==
